This brand is experiencing rapid growth, offering excellent career progression opportunities. This role reports to the Transportation Manager, overseeing all upstream logistics. It is responsible for managing the movement of goods from the factory to the warehouse, ensuring efficiency in dispatches and deliveries. The Upstream Logistics Coordinator plays a crucial role in overseeing and optimizing the inbound supply chain processes, ensuring timely and accurate receipt of goods and materials. Responsibilities: Organize and oversee all finished goods upstream shipments via air and road freight, ensuring prompt dispatch and tracking through to delivery into the Distribution Centre (DC). Assist the Transportation Manager in selecting optimal transport methods to improve cost efficiency and delivery timelines. Prepare and submit customs documentation accurately and efficiently, ensuring smooth clearance and compliance with regulations. Coordinate with warehouses to facilitate the efficient receipt, quality inspection, and storage of goods. Manage and process shipping documents, ensuring accuracy and timely updates. Plan and determine the most cost-effective routes for upstream shipments. Maintain precise records of all logistics activities and update internal systems accordingly. Ensure adherence to transportation regulations and full compliance with company policies. Oversee daily shipments of raw materials and finished goods, ensuring timely dispatch and delivery. Address and resolve any shipping or customs-related issues swiftly and effectively. Manage ASN (Advance Shipping Notice) creation and track shipments in Zedonk.
